Deputy Prime Minister and Union Minister for Foreign Affairs U Than Swe and ASEAN Special Envoy for Myanmar H.E. Alounkeo Kittikhoun met at the Sapphire Hall of PARK ROYAL Hotel in Nay Pyi Taw at 11:30 am on January 10, sources said.

During the meeting, they discussed the processes that will be carried out in cooperation with the ASEAN Alternate Chairman and the ASEAN Special Envoy for Myanmar to make progress in implementing the five-point consensus of ASEAN in accordance with the five forward processes of Myanmar and humanitarian aid issues.

In addition, the Deputy Prime Minister also explained the implementation of Myanmar's peace process and the current state of domestic political development.

The Union Minister for Home Affairs, Lieutenant General Yar Pyae met the delegation led by ASEAN Special Envoy for Myanmar H.E. Alounkeo Kittikhoun at the National Unity and Peacemaking Center in Nay Pyi Taw at 2:00 pm on January 10.

During the meeting, they exchanged views on issues related to Myanmar's peace process, peace talks with ethnic armed groups, actions on the five-point consensus of ASEAN and issues related to humanitarian aid.

The meeting was attended by member of the National Unity and Peacemaking Coordination Committee Lieutenant General Sein Win (Retired), Lieutenant General Win Bo Shein, Ambassador (retired) U San Lwin and officials.
